Roxanne de Bastion is a singer songwriter and artist advocate. She has released two critically acclaimed albums that have been championed by the likes of Iggy Popand has garnered praise in The Observer, NMEand Rolling Stone Germany. Roxanne sits on the board of the Featured Artist Coalition (alongside artists such as Blur’s Dave Rowntree and Imogen Heap) and the PPL Performer Board, where she represents artists’ rights. Roxanne is also the founder of the independent artist conference FM2U (From Me To You), which encourages artists to support and learn from one another.
